Security fixes target the latest published release.
Use GitHub private vulnerability reporting. You may also email support@xquik.com.
Do not open a public issue. Do not include secrets in screenshots, logs, or examples.
We aim to acknowledge reports within 3 business days. We coordinate disclosure after confirming the issue.
Security-sensitive areas include:
- API key and token handling
- Request construction and redirects
- Terminal output and local files
- Dependencies and generated code
- Release binaries, checksums, and provenance
Act in good faith and avoid privacy violations. Do not disrupt services or access unrelated data. We will not pursue good-faith research following this policy.
